#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ct Fopid<S: ControlScalar, const N: usize> {
kp: S,
ki: S,
kd: S,
u_min: S,
u_max: S,
int_op: GrunwaldLeibniz<S, N>,
diff_op: GrunwaldLeibniz<S, N>,
saturated: bool,
}
impl<S: ControlScalar, const N: usize> Fopid<S, N> {
pub fn update(&mut self, setpoint: S, measurement: S) -> S {
let error = setpoint - measurement;
let p_term = self.kp * error;
let d_raw = self.diff_op.update(error);
let d_term = self.kd * d_raw;
let pre_integral = self.int_op.update(error);
let i_term = if self.saturated {
let tentative = p_term + d_term;
let sat_high = tentative > self.u_max;
let sat_low = tentative < self.u_min;
let freeze = (sat_high && error > S::ZERO) || (sat_low && error < S::ZERO);
if freeze {
S::ZERO } else {
self.ki * pre_integral
}
} else {
self.ki * pre_integral
};
let output_raw = p_term + i_term + d_term;
let output = output_raw.clamp_val(self.u_min, self.u_max);
self.saturated = (output_raw - output).abs() > S::EPSILON;
output
}
pub fn reset(&mut self) {
self.int_op.reset();
self.diff_op.reset();
self.saturated = false;
}
#[inline]
pub fn is_saturated(&self) -> bool {
self.saturated
}
#[inline]
pub fn kp(&self) -> S {
self.kp
}
#[inline]
pub fn ki(&self) -> S {
self.ki
}
#[inline]
pub fn kd(&self) -> S {
self.kd
}
}

fn evaluate_fopid_frequency<S: ControlScalar>(
kp: S,
ki: S,
lambda: S,
kd: S,
mu: S,
omega: S,
) -> (S, S) {
let half_pi = S::PI * S::HALF;
let omega_neg_lambda = omega.powf(S::ZERO - lambda);
let phase_neg_lambda = (S::ZERO - lambda) * half_pi; let i_re = ki * omega_neg_lambda * phase_neg_lambda.cos();
let i_im = ki * omega_neg_lambda * phase_neg_lambda.sin();
let omega_mu = omega.powf(mu);
let phase_mu = mu * half_pi; let d_re = kd * omega_mu * phase_mu.cos();
let d_im = kd * omega_mu * phase_mu.sin();
let c_re = kp + i_re + d_re;
let c_im = i_im + d_im;
let angle_rad = c_im.atan2(c_re);
let angle_deg = angle_rad * S::from_f64(180.0 / core::f64::consts::PI);
let phase_margin = S::from_f64(180.0) + angle_deg;
(phase_margin, omega)
}
